Transaction 31a0eda6989f2d7f02c8be4a1926c23ac30c48f384d6ae7cf3ed9dc9bbe4b239

1 Input
2 Outputs
  • 31a0eda6989f2d7f02c8be4a1926c23ac30c48f384d6ae7cf3ed9dc9bbe4b239:0
  • value  100000000
    address  1CFQjBExQZDDPDv7pADMaav4hMcH95B3Vg
  • 31a0eda6989f2d7f02c8be4a1926c23ac30c48f384d6ae7cf3ed9dc9bbe4b239:1
  • value  337809633
    address  3ApNSdVUbNPhDguxW5yDZX1zMnFPdoHZsE